Position Description:

The Kentucky Spinal Cord Injury Research Center is seeking a Research Assistant III to join our research team focused on Neuroscience and Spinal Cord Injury (SCI) research. The successful candidate will support ongoing basic and translational research projects investigating neural repair, neuromodulation, and functional recovery using advanced experimental and analytical approaches. This position offers an excellent opportunity to gain hands-on experience in cutting- edge neuroscience research within a collaborative academic environment. This is a grant funded position.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Support animal-based experiments, including rodent handling, behavioral testing, and post-operative monitoring.
  • Perform laboratory techniques including tissue processing, histology, immunohistochemistry, microscopy, and molecular assays.
  • Assist with injections and experimental surgeries (training provided as needed).
  • Maintain accurate experimental records and assist with data organization and analysis.
  • Maintain equipment, lab organization, and supply inventory.
  • Follow institutional safety, IACUC, and research compliance protocols.
  • Participate in lab meetings and contribute to collaborative research activities.
